项目经理 - CB3 - NM 职位描述 Core Responsibilities: • Full Project lifecycle management, Lead the entire project process from feasibility study, basic design, detailed design, procurement, construction, pre commissioning, commissioning, start-up, performance testing, till project close out. • Act as the project key contact point, maintaining effective communication with internal functions (Procurement, Operations, Technology, Quality, EHS, Finance, etc.), external resources (design institutes, contractors, government authorities, and third parties) to ensure clear communication and aligned project objectives. • Lead a project team comprising internal specialists and external consultants, define roles clearly, motivate team members, and foster a collaborative and high-performance work environment. • Identify and assess project technical, management, and financial risks; develop and execute effective mitigation strategies. • Establish and maintain a "Zero-tolerance" safety policy. Ensure all project activities strictly adhere to company EHS standards and local Chinese regulations, aiming for zero incidents. • Quality Control: Supervise project quality management system to ensure all aspects of design, procurement, and construction meet technical specifications, industry standards, and company quality target requirements. • Budget & Cost Control: Be responsible for the development, monitoring, and control of the overall project scope and budget. Accurately forecast cost trends, manage project scope and change orders, and ensure project costs are controlled within approved budget. • Schedule Management: Develop and maintain the project's overall milestones and execution plan. Track project progress, identify critical paths, mitigate schedule risks, and ensure timely project delivery. • Support procurement for contract &change negotiation, execution, and dispute resolution. • Organize mechanical completion acceptance, handover and support operation for commissioning and Start-up. Key Job Requirements: • Bachelor's degree or higher in Chemical Engineering or equivalent. • Experience in chemical production or process engineering is a strong plus. • 10+ years of project management experience in chemical projects. .Experience with new plant setup, process scale-up, or major technical renovation projects. (greenfield or brownfield expansion). • Good communication skills and teamwork spirit. • Basic English text processing ability. Our Company: Axalta has remained at the forefront of the coatings industry by continually investing in innovative solutions. We engineer technologies that protect customers’ products – whether they are battling heat, light, corrosion, abrasion, moisture, or chemicals – and add dimension and beauty with colorful finishes. We have a vast and ever-evolving portfolio of brands primed to play an important part in everything from modernizing infrastructure around the world to enabling the next generation of electric and autonomous vehicles. Axalta operates its business in two segments: Performance Coatings and Mobility Coatings, which serve four end markets, including Refinish, Industrial, Light Vehicle and Commercial Vehicle, across North America, EMEA, Latin America and Asia-Pacific. Our diverse global footprint allows us to deliver solutions in over 140+ countries and coat 30 million vehicles per year. We’ve recently set an exciting 2040 carbon neutrality goal, in addition to 10 other sustainability initiatives, and we take pride in working with our customers to optimize their businesses and achieve their goals.
